Wayne Meade

After an early profession as a piano accompanist culminated in a tour of Europe with the Canadian Welsh Singers, Wayne began to focus on another life passion; teaching music. Wayne was once asked why he made the transition from music performance to the music classroom. His reply? “Music is the universal language of communication. The classroom is not far removed from the concert hall in terms of sharing music with others. However, children often have the gift of understanding music at a much deeper level, which is evident in their unbelievable creativity on and off the stage.”

Wayne is a Ontario certified teacher in good standing with the Ontario College of Teachers. He received his Bachelor of Music Education degree in 1992, and his Bachelor of Education degree in 1993. When Wayne is not teaching music in the afternoon, he is the school librarian for the Elementary helping students with their research. Working under the supervision of the teaching staff, Wayne assists students who need remedial help.

After 18 years, Meadesmith School of Music and Drama has grown to include not only piano lessons, but guitar, band/vocal tutoring, musical theatre after-school and camp programs. Since 1999, Wayne has been providing a musical classroom environment at ML Montessori Schools Inc. which nurtures musical creativity in children.
